SR08 AZT is a 2008 Suzuki Gsxr 600 K8 in Blue with a 599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2008 Suzuki Gsxr 600 K8 models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.6% with a typical mileage of 11,039 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Gsxr 600 K8 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 52 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SR08 AZT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Gsxr 600 K8 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 18 years old, this Suzuki Gsxr 600 K8 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
